Skip to content

chore: release v16#4418

Merged
asmitahase merged 55 commits intoversion-16from
version-16-hotfix
Apr 22, 2026
Merged

chore: release v16#4418
asmitahase merged 55 commits intoversion-16from
version-16-hotfix

Conversation

@frappe-pr-bot
Copy link
Copy Markdown
Collaborator

Automated Release.

ruthra-kumar and others added 30 commits April 16, 2026 12:16
(cherry picked from commit 9626ad7)

# Conflicts:
#	hrms/hooks.py
(cherry picked from commit 05c4afd)
(cherry picked from commit 0e89c28)
…4394

refactor: restrict reposting to only supported doctypes (backport #4394)
…4399

fix(test): missing repost defaults (backport #4399)
…llowed cap set in leave type

(cherry picked from commit 5f7ea0d)
…ned leave exceeds leave type limit

fix: set the partially allocated earned leave in the schedule
test: partially allocated earned leave in the schedule

(cherry picked from commit cabfb23)
(cherry picked from commit 0e06b33)
…4398

fix: allocate earned leaves as applicable patially when max allowed leave limit is hit (backport #4398)
(cherry picked from commit a8b15d3)
(cherry picked from commit cf0b0b4)

# Conflicts:
#	hrms/hr/doctype/interview/interview.py
#	hrms/hr/doctype/interview_round/interview_round.js
#	hrms/hr/doctype/interview_round/interview_round.py
#	hrms/hr/doctype/job_applicant/job_applicant.js
#	hrms/hr/doctype/job_applicant/job_applicant.py
#	hrms/patches.txt
fix(Interview Type): missing type hints for whilelisted methods
fix(Job Applicant): missing type hints for whilelisted methods

(cherry picked from commit 92527aa)

# Conflicts:
#	hrms/hr/doctype/interview/interview.py
fix: make designation part of job opening template

(cherry picked from commit 19e8051)
fix(Job Opening Template): make pay details part of job opening template

(cherry picked from commit e8ff733)
fix(Job Applicant): added 3 coumn layout in the first section
fix(Job Applicant): reordered resume section

(cherry picked from commit f8ed6ea)
fix(Job Applicant): filter interview type by designation while creating interview
fix(Job Applicant): new Shortlisted status

(cherry picked from commit 21b424e)

# Conflicts:
#	hrms/hr/doctype/job_applicant/job_applicant.py
…licants

fix: moved Salary Expeactations to new tab
fix: moved source section at the bottom

(cherry picked from commit 89957a6)
fix: make get_interview_details return None instead of partical dictionary if no interview exists

(cherry picked from commit 90306fb)
fix: show button to open resume link in new tab if preview fails

(cherry picked from commit 649a99b)
fix: change height of review frame to 1000px

(cherry picked from commit 87a24bd)
(cherry picked from commit 849d6a2)

# Conflicts:
#	hrms/patches.txt
(cherry picked from commit bca1962)
(cherry picked from commit b411191)

# Conflicts:
#	hrms/hr/doctype/interview/interview.py
#	hrms/hr/doctype/interview_feedback/interview_feedback.py
asmitahase and others added 21 commits April 16, 2026 23:50
(cherry picked from commit 9f0f805)
(cherry picked from commit a497440)
…leave, create resource for hr settings

(cherry picked from commit 0fae64e)
(cherry picked from commit e4dee64)
(cherry picked from commit 3e9fee7)

# Conflicts:
#	hrms/hr/doctype/job_opening_template/job_opening_template.json
…doctypes in frappe app

(cherry picked from commit c6e46fc)

# Conflicts:
#	hrms/hr/doctype/job_applicant/job_applicant.json
#	hrms/hr/doctype/job_opening/job_opening.json
#	hrms/hr/doctype/job_opening_template/job_opening_template.json
#	hrms/setup.py
(cherry picked from commit 4a8fff8)

# Conflicts:
#	hrms/setup.py
(cherry picked from commit 4ad1dec)

# Conflicts:
#	hrms/hr/doctype/job_opening_template/job_opening_template.json
(cherry picked from commit 3e8274a)

# Conflicts:
#	hrms/setup.py
… docperm

(cherry picked from commit 37158b6)

# Conflicts:
#	hrms/setup.py
(cherry picked from commit 739fdfb)

# Conflicts:
#	hrms/patches.txt
(cherry picked from commit 44ca81e)

# Conflicts:
#	hrms/hr/doctype/job_opening_template/job_opening_template.json
…post Accounting Ledger Settings is merged into accounts settings

(cherry picked from commit af99a2f)

# Conflicts:
#	hrms/hr/doctype/expense_claim/test_expense_claim.py
@asmitahase
Copy link
Copy Markdown
Member

Tests pass, typehints can go later, merging!

@asmitahase asmitahase merged commit 78d3f90 into version-16 Apr 22, 2026
13 of 14 checks passed
@frappe-pr-bot
Copy link
Copy Markdown
Collaborator Author

🎉 This PR is included in version 16.5.1 🎉

The release is available on GitHub release

Your semantic-release bot 📦🚀

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

Projects

None yet

Development

Successfully merging this pull request may close these issues.

5 participants